MP-210059, N03/N04 Zurich Western Bypass, Maintenance BSA, ExpM / QS BSA Tunnel Ventilation + Control Systems D-x-3-3 ExpM Ventilation+Control (Phases SIA 31 – 53)
Realization works are carried out on site (within the project perimeter). Meetings and inspections take place at the ASTRA branch in Winterthur, on the project perimeter or in the premises of the contractor or other companies.
N03 / N04 Zurich Western Bypass was opened in stages in 2006 and 2009. The Federal Roads Office ASTRA plans to renovate the operational and safety systems (BSA). Additionally, measures are planned according to the Roadmap VM-CH project (PUN). Furthermore, GHGW and RaDo reduce congestion formation. In the course of these works, measures to implement the federal energy strategy are also being realized. This demanding expert mandate with emphasis on "implementation expertise under ongoing BSA operation in night closures" comprises interdisciplinary tasks and quality assurance for tunnel ventilation and other BSA subject areas. As a mandate characteristic, high on-site presence at night, including key personnel, is emphasized. Due to the complex task "QS BSA for maintenance under traffic", with reference to the heavily trafficked route section, this mandate includes an on-call service. In this mandate (D-x-3-3), quality assurance of the design is carried out for the phases measure concept and project as well as for procurement. During realization, the implementation of the design is supervised (execution documents, execution, commissioning). The scope of services thus encompasses phases SIA 31 – 53.
